The Organizational Setting
The International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O) is the United Nations (UN) designated organization in charge of ensuring continuous leadership on environmental issues relating to international civil aviation, including the reduction of Greenhouse Gas (GHG) emissions. In this regard, ICAO provides capacity-building assistance to its Member States to help them develop States Action Plans and implement measures to mitigate CO2 emissions from international aviation. Coherent with itsย No Country Left Behindย initiative, ICAO launched in 2013 the first ICAO Assistance Project with European Union (EU) Funding, successfully supporting 14 States in Africa and the Caribbean during its first phase and five States from the Eastern and Southern African Region, and five from the Western and Central African Region on its second phase. Seven feasibility studies were conducted in certain selected States.ย Information on this project and its final results, can be foundย here.
Building on this successful partnership with the EU, ICAO initiated in 2023 a new Assistance Project with EU funding: Capacity building for sustainable aviation fuels (SAF) eligible under the Carbon Offsetting and Reduction Scheme for International Aviation (CORSIA). The project supports the ICAO ACT-SAF global initiative launched in 2022,ย aiming to provide opportunities for States to develop their full potential in SAF development and deployment. This new Assistance Project has a strong geographic focus on India and the African continent where the action shall be carried out. Additional or substituting countries shall be defined with the agreement of all parties, duly justified, and respecting the strong geographical focus mentioned above.
The provision of capacity-building will be made in the form of feasibility studies on the development of SAF for Ten States expecting to empower the governments of these States to take steps towards the production of SAF in their territory to contribute to the mitigation of CO2 emissions from international civil aviation and achieve the objectives of the ICAO Global Framework for SAF, LCAF and other Aviation Cleaner Energies agreed in 2023. These studies may vary on size complexity and scope depending on specific circumstances of the State in the moment of launching the project and on the analysis of whether previous work was undertaken, so the definition of the Study will avoid any duplications a be adapted to such context.ย
